The Strunk Busy Beaver is another neat little snapshot of mid-1950s chainsaw design. The saw is heavy, geared, and built to be a practical one-man saw.

Specifications

SpecDetails
ModelStrunk Busy Beaver
ManufacturerStrunk Manufacturing Co., Coatesville, Pennsylvania, U.S.A.
Year introduced1956
Engine1-cylinder
Cylinder/intakeAluminum cylinder with cast iron sleeve; reed valve intake
Power4 hp / 2.98 kW
Weight28 lb / 12.7 kg with 16 in / 40 cm bar and chain
Clutch/driveCentrifugal clutch with gear reduction drive, 3:1 ratio
Construction/finishSand cast aluminum with red enamel finish
Ignition/starterWico FW2288 or FW2385 magneto; Fairbanks Morse automatic rewind starter
Carburetor/air filterTillotson HP-12A diaphragm carburetor; Skinner ribbon element air filter
Oiling systemPositive gravity feed
Maximum engine speed4,500 rpm
Ignition settingsTiming 0.250 in / 6.35 mm before TDC; breaker points 0.020 in / 0.51 mm
Spark plug/gapChampion J8J, Autolite A7X, or AC M45; 0.030 in / 0.76 mm gap
Main bearingsBall
Fuel tank capacity2 U.S. quarts / 64 fl oz / 1.89 L
Fuel mix1/2 pint oil to 1 gallon gasoline, or 16:1
Recommended fuel/oilRegular gasoline; SAE 30 motor oil
Chain spec1/2 in pitch, .058 gauge; Strunk Type B chain
Guide bar lengths16–24 in / 40–61 cm

The Busy Beaver looks a lot like the earlier Eager Beaver, but it was really the tougher follow-up. On paper, the Busy Beaver steps up to 4 hp instead of 2.5 hp, uses a Tillotson HP-12A/H12A diaphragm carb instead of the Eager Beaver’s MD-60A float carb, runs a higher listed max rpm, and was sold with a wider bar range.
